Ryan Adams’ tour rolled through a familiar stop as the singer-songwriter played the Cork Opera House in Cork, IRE yesterday and decided to have a whole lot of fun. Deviating from his usual setlist, Adams performed a lengthy solo section in the middle of the show, offering up acoustic versions of “New York, New York,” “Two,” “La Cienga Just Smiled” as well as newer tunes like “Trouble” and the rarely played “Let Go.” He would also improv a song about his cat later on and revisited his Bryan Adams cover.

The cherry on top, however, was this performance of “She’s Like the Wind.” Yes, that song. From Dirty Dancing with Patrick Swayze. With the help of Natalie Prass, Adams took to the mic for an intimate take on the power ballad. Unfortunately, the attached choreography was left out.
